Re: [Trac] Re: Plugin for additional Attributes for Tickets?

2011-05-17 Thread Ethan Jucovy
On Tue, May 17, 2011 at 12:18 PM, Voelker, Bernhard 
bernhard.voel...@siemens-enterprise.com wrote:

 Ethan Jucovy  wrote:

  It should be present in the web admin too.  Do you see a link to Custom
 Fields
  in the admin navbar, under Ticket System?  You can add, edit and remove
 custom
  ticket fields from there.

 not here on 0.12.2, is this a 0.13.x feature?


Whoops -- the web admin is provided in a plugin, I didn't realize.
http://trac-hacks.org/wiki/CustomFieldAdminPlugin, compatible with 0.11 and
0.12, I guess I've been using it so long I forgot it wasn't core :)

-Ethan
